A nation is a group of people who share a common culture, history, or language and typically inhabit a particular territory. Nationality refers to a person's legal relationship to a particular nation, typically based on birth or naturalization, and is often associated with citizenship. In essence, a nation is a collective identity, while nationality is an individual legal status.

What is the difference in value between what a nation imports and what it exports?

The difference in value between what a nation imports and what it exports is called the trade balance. If a country exports more than it imports, it has a trade surplus. If it imports more than it exports, it has a trade deficit. A balanced trade is when a country's imports and exports are equal.
